How does Dough handle seasonal businesses? +

Better than the big processors. Most processors charge fixed monthly junk fees — PCI, statement, batch, network access — that hurt in your slow months because they don't flex with volume.

Our pricing models flex. If you do $80K in July and $8K in February, your actual fees follow the volume — no padding the monthly to hide it. We also offer surcharging, which goes to $0 processing fees on credit cards regardless of season.

How fast can a Niagara business get set up? +

Two to three days from start to installed. The terminal ships pre-programmed for your business — you plug it in and process. Underwriting takes one to two business days. The terminal arrives via courier within another day or two. Your bank account doesn't change. Your bookkeeping doesn't change. Just the processor and the terminal.

Do you offer surcharging for Niagara businesses? +

Yes. Surcharging is legal in Ontario, which means Niagara merchants can run a 2.4% credit card surcharge program and effectively pay $0 in processing fees on credit transactions. Particularly good for auto repair, trades, and high-ticket service businesses.

For restaurants and retail with smaller average tickets, dual pricing or Interchange Plus may be the better fit. Read our full surcharging guide for the breakdown.

What terminals do you offer for Niagara businesses? +

The full Clover lineup — Clover Flex (most popular for tourism-strip businesses), Clover Mini, Clover Station Duo (for full POS restaurants), Clover Flex Pocket — plus the Newland N910 and Ingenico Desk 5000. For online or B2B businesses, we set up Authorize.Net or Converge. See all terminals.

Terminal pricing is determined on the sales call based on your contract structure. Free terminals are available for qualified Pro and Premium tier merchants.
